dc.description.abstractThe cognitive users (CUs) in the cooperative communication may serve as relay nodes for conveying the signal received from the primary users (PUs) to their destinations, provided that both the PUs and the CUs minimum rate requirements are satisfied. The PUs are motivated to cooperate by the incentive of achieving a higher PU rate with reduced power requirement, while concurrently allowing an access to CUs to share their spectral band. The existing cooperative schemes do not improve the simultaneous transmission rate of both PUs and CUs. In this paper, an incremental pragmatic distribution algorithm (IPDA) is proposed, which provides efficient spectral access with an improved simultaneous transmission performance of both CUs and PUs. The obtained results by employing the proposed algorithm show that our scheme offers relatively better performance of PUs and CUs with low overhead than the conventional distributed cooperative communication schemes.
